What is the movie Hold On To Your Angels about?
Hold On To Your Angels is an upcoming outlaw romance film directed by Benh Zeitlin. Starring Paul Mescal and Jessie Buckley, the story follows a hell-bound outlaw and a shepherd of lost souls who fall in love against the backdrop of a crumbling Louisiana bayou paradise.

What is the Plot of the Hold On To Your Angels Movie?
Set on the jagged, eroding edge of the South Louisiana bayou, the Hold On To Your Angels plot is described by Zeitlin as an "outlaw romance for the end of America." The narrative explores a "crumbling bayou paradise" that threatens to drag its protagonists under as they navigate their impossible connection. This Louisiana bayou film setting is not merely a backdrop; it is a central character representing an "endangered way of life."
The film aims to be a "rallying cry for empathy across a fractured planet," using the intimate lens of a romance to address broader themes of environmental decay and social isolation. Expect a story that balances the gritty reality of the bayou with the mythic realism that Zeitlin pioneered in his previous works.
Director Benh Zeitlin’s Vision: From 'Beasts' to 'Angels'
For fans of Benh Zeitlin’s new film, the road to this production has been nearly two decades in the making. Zeitlin revealed that he has been dreaming of this story since Pam Harper walked into an audition for Beasts of the Southern Wild 17 years ago. Harper, who served as the primary inspiration for the film’s "hero," represents the authentic, soulful spirit of the region that Zeitlin seeks to capture.
This 17-year development process suggests a deeply personal project. Much like Beasts of the Southern Wild, which famously utilized non-professional actors to achieve a sense of hyper-authenticity, there is speculation that Zeitlin may once again surround his lead stars with local residents of the bayou. This technique, combined with his signature handheld, immersive cinematography, is expected to create a visual style that feels both grounded and otherworldly.

Production Details: Plan B, Cannes, and Filming Dates
The Plan B upcoming movies slate is bolstered by this project, as the production powerhouse (known for Moonlight and 12 Years a Slave) joins forces with Alex Coco of Rapt Film. The collaboration signals a high level of confidence in the film’s commercial and critical potential. The project became one of the hottest titles at the Cannes Market 2024 news cycle, where international sales were handled by The Veterans and domestic rights represented by CAA Media Finance.
- Production Start: Principal photography is scheduled to begin in February 2027.
- Filming Locations: While specific towns haven't been named, the production will be centered in the deep South Louisiana bayou.
